VanMeter Picks Up Singles Win On Senior Day

VanMeter Picks Up Singles Win On Senior Day

CLEVELAND, Ohio – Senior Joe VanMeter picked up a win a No. 2 singles on Senior Day Sunday morning, as the Cleveland State men's tennis team dropped a 5-2 decision to Green Bay. Cleveland State now stands at 11-10 overall this year and 1-3 in league play.

"We definitely had our chances to get the win today, and I felt like we could have beat this team, but unfortunately we weren't able to come away victorious. We will take this experience and keep growing from it and move forward to the final week of the regular season," head coach Brian Etzkin said. "We have come to count on our doubles, and getting that point every single time, and that didn't happen for us today. Dropping the doubles point was a bit frustrating and it got us off on the wrong foot, but I thought the team did a good job of bouncing back in singles play and put up a good fight against a solid Green Bay team."

VanMeter's victory at the No. 2 singles spot came as a 6-1, 6-4 decision, and marked his 10th victory of the Spring season. The win also moved him into a tie for sixth place on the CSU Singles Wins list, as he now has 71 career singles victories.

Cleveland State's second point came from freshman Benjamin Slade, who picked up a 6-3, 3-6, 1-0 (8) victory at No. 5 singles. Slade now stands at 19-13 overall this year – just one win shy of becoming the seventh Viking to record a 20-win season during their rookie campaigns.

 "Joe and Ben were able to pick up a pair of good singles wins for us today, highlighting the tough singles effort that we had on the court. Ben had a really exciting match – winning in a super tiebreaker after dropping the second set. We will now look forward to getting another league win next weekend, traveling to UIC and Valparaiso," Etzkin said.

The Vikings will close out regular season league play on the road next weekend, traveling to UIC (Saturday, April 23) and Valparaiso (Sunday, April 24).
